From the myWireless Account home page, select Phone/Device then choose the Reset Voice Mail PIN link from the left column. Note: If there is more than one line on the account, make sure the correct wireless number is displayed in the Wireless Number list before selecting Reset Voice Mail PIN. To reset the password for any of the lines on the account, choose a wireless number from the dropdown menu and click Submit. In a while, iPhone will display "Password Incorrect - Enter Voicemail Password." Enter the last seven digits of the wireless phone number and tap OK. Log into My Verizon with your cell phone number and password. If you've set up a username, use the username instead of your phone number. Select My Verizon> Reset Voice Mail Password. Choose your cell phone number from the drop-down menu, and thenclick on "I Will Create My Own Password." Enter and confirm your new password. Click on "Submit" to save the change. Sign in to My Sprint with your username and password. Click“My preferences” tab. Under Things I can manage online, click on Change voicemail passcode. Enter your new passcode and confirm. Tap Save and you will get a message informing you the new password has been saved.

Important note: In some states, such as California, it’s illegal to record calls or conversations without permission from all parties involved. If that’s the case, ask your call participants if it’s OK if you record the conversation before you start recording. Then, ask again once you do start recording—so you have their permission on record. Alternatively, if you state “I’m recording this call for [whatever purpose]” and your contact stays on the line, that’s OK as well.
On the iPhone, go into voicemail and tap "Greeting". Record a few seconds of something and tap stop. Before you tap save, use iFuntastic or SFTP to navigate to /var/root/Library/Voicemail on your iPhone. You'll see a file called "Greeting. amr". This is the audio you just recorded. Delete that file and replace it with your custom message which should then be renamed to "Greeting.amr". Tap "Play" on the iPhone to verify your message works. If it plays, tap "Save" and your custom message will be uploaded to AT&T's servers.

Some mobile networks automatically set up a default PIN for your voicemail system, which may be something as simple as ‘1234’. That’s really easy to guess, so if someone knows your mobile phone number then they may be able to get into your voicemail just by guessing your PIN.
